Appearance

The Full Grown Fawn Pied French Bulldog is a small to medium-sized breed with a sturdy and muscular build. They have a compact and well-balanced body, with a broad chest and a short, smooth coat. The coat color of the Fawn Pied French Bulldog is predominantly fawn, with patches of white on the face, chest, and body.

Their head is large and square-shaped, with a short and wide muzzle. They have a wrinkled forehead and a well-defined stop. The eyes of the Fawn Pied French Bulldog are round and dark in color, giving them an alert and intelligent expression. Their ears are bat-like and set high on the head, giving them a distinctive appearance.

Their tail is short and set low, typically straight or with a slight curve. The legs of the Fawn Pied French Bulldog are short and muscular, with well-developed thighs. They have compact and round feet, with well-arched toes.

Overall, the Full Grown Fawn Pied French Bulldog has a charming and adorable appearance, with a unique combination of fawn and white coloring. Their compact and muscular build adds to their overall appeal, making them a popular choice among dog lovers.

Temperament

Temperament

The Full Grown Fawn Pied French Bulldog is known for its friendly and affectionate temperament. They are extremely loyal and love to be around their owners. These dogs are great companions and are always eager to please.

They have a playful nature and enjoy spending time with children and other pets. They are known to be patient and gentle with kids, making them an ideal family pet. However, it is important to supervise interactions between the dog and young children to ensure they are both safe.

This breed is also known for its intelligence and adaptability. They are quick learners and are easy to train. With consistent and positive reinforcement, they can quickly pick up commands and tricks.

Despite their small size, Full Grown Fawn Pied French Bulldogs have a protective nature and will alert their owners to any potential danger. They make excellent watchdogs and will bark to notify their owners of any unusual activity or strangers approaching.

Care Requirements

Care Requirements

Taking care of a full grown fawn pied French Bulldog requires dedication and attention to their specific needs. Here are some essential care requirements for this breed:

Diet

Diet

A well-balanced diet is crucial for the overall health and well-being of a full grown fawn pied French Bulldog. It is recommended to feed them high-quality dog food that is specifically formulated for small breeds. Avoid overfeeding, as French Bulldogs are prone to obesity. Consult with a veterinarian to determine the appropriate portion sizes and feeding schedule for your dog.

Exercise

Despite their small size, French Bulldogs require regular exercise to maintain a healthy weight and prevent boredom. Daily walks and playtime in a secure area are recommended. However, it is important to avoid excessive exercise in hot weather due to their brachycephalic (short-nosed) structure, which can make it difficult for them to regulate their body temperature.

Grooming

Grooming

The fawn pied French Bulldog has a short and smooth coat that is relatively low maintenance. Regular brushing with a soft bristle brush will help remove loose hair and keep their coat looking shiny. They are moderate shedders, so occasional baths may be necessary. Additionally, it is important to clean their ears regularly to prevent infections and trim their nails as needed.

Health Care

Health Care

Regular veterinary check-ups are essential for the health and well-being of a full grown fawn pied French Bulldog. They are prone to certain health issues, including respiratory problems, allergies, and joint disorders. It is important to stay up to date with vaccinations, flea and tick prevention, and heartworm medication. Additionally, dental care, such as regular teeth brushing and professional cleanings, is crucial to prevent dental diseases.

Overall, providing proper care for a full grown fawn pied French Bulldog involves meeting their dietary needs, providing regular exercise, maintaining their grooming needs, and ensuring their overall health through regular veterinary care. With proper care and attention, your French Bulldog can live a happy and healthy life.
